19 - Pathways to Peace and Happiness | Swami Tattwamayananda


Chapter 2 Verses 66-69. The lecture was given by Swami Tattwamayananda on June 28, 2019.
-going beyond the tyranny of the senses and the sense-objects
-how to be in peace with ourselves
-the quest for tranquility of mind [prasada प्रसाद:]
-going beyond infatuation/ fascination and aversion: keeping the senses under restraint: way to perfect tranquility of mind
-Shankaracharya on प्रसाद:
-“प्रसाद: प्रसन्नता स्वास्थ्यम्” (Shankaracharya’s commentary on BG.II.64)
-Harmonizing the senses
-The tragedy of human life: being driven around by the senses and sense-objects
-Our actions reflect our mind
-How the boat of life gets capsized by the stormy waves and fierce winds of the senses and sense-objects
-Beyond likes and dislikes
-How to be in peace with oneself
-Quest for harmony within
-Need of consistency in conviction and practices
-Managing the mind through भावना (meditation) and linking the mind to the Transcendental
-Poet Kalidasa on the dangers of possessing power without wisdom
-No peace, no enlightenment for the unsteady
-How to remain spiritually ever awakened
-Days and nights in spiritual awareness: the contrasting pictures of the wise and the ignorant
-Our spiritual obligation to ourselves
-Steadying the mind by observing, by being its witness
